John 4:1-9 New Century Version (NCV)

1. The Pharisees heard that Jesus was making and baptizing more followers than John,

2. although Jesus himself did not baptize people, but his followers did.

3. Jesus knew that the Pharisees had heard about him, so he left Judea and went back to Galilee.

4. But on the way he had to go through the country of Samaria.

5. In Samaria Jesus came to the town called Sychar, which is near the field Jacob gave to his son Joseph.

6. Jacob’s well was there. Jesus was tired from his long trip, so he sat down beside the well. It was about twelve o’clock noon.

7. When a Samaritan woman came to the well to get some water, Jesus said to her, “Please give me a drink.”

8. (This happened while Jesus’ followers were in town buying some food.)

9. The woman said, “I am surprised that you ask me for a drink, since you are a Jewish man and I am a Samaritan woman.” (Jewish people are not friends with Samaritans.)
